
The average Poly UX Researcher earns an estimated $130,752 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$117,717 with a $13,035 bonus. Poly's UX Researcher compensation is $34,355 more than the US average for a UX Researcher. UX Researcher salaries at Poly can range from $60,000 - $200,000.

UX Researchers earn $6,151 more than UI/UX Designers, and $16,429 less than Senior Designers.
The Design Department averages $1,762 more than the IT Department, and $3,232 less than the HR Department
The average female UX Researcher at companies similar size to Poly reported making $102,788, while the average male UX Researcher at similar sized companies reported making $101,646.
The average Hispanic or Latino UX Researcher at companies similar size to Poly reported making $109,625, while the average Caucasian UX Researcher at similar sized companies reported making $94,559.
The majority of UX Researchers at Poly believe they're compensated fairly. 57% of UX Researchers at Poly say they receive annual bonuses, and the vast majority (71%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at Poly
